If you are looking for a gym to visit, there are several options available. Anytime Fitness and LA Fitness are two popular choices. Both gyms offer a variety of equipment and workout programs. However, each offers different advantages.

One advantage of Anytime Fitness is that members can access the facility at any time. Members are also encouraged to work with a trainer. These trainers are qualified and have certifications from accredited institutions.

Depending on the location, personal training sessions cost $35 -$45 per hour. Some locations also offer a free introductory session. Personal training is a valuable resource to help achieve your health goals.

Anytime Fitness has over 4,500 locations in the US, Canada, and Europe. The average location is 3,000 to 5,000 square feet. Each location has up to five to ten personal trainers.

In addition to personal training, the facility offers small group training classes. learning about personal training can be a great way to meet new people and work out at the same time.
